The point slope form of a line that has a slope of -2 and passes through point (5,-2) is shown below.

Mathematics
1 answer:
Likurg_2 [28]2 years ago
4 0
Insert the point, (5,-2) with the slope of the line to figure out the equation. You can either use point-slope form, or plug it for for slope-intercept form.

Slope-intercept form:
-2 = -2(5) + b
-2 = -10 + b
Add 10 on both sides
8 = b

Thus,

y = -2x + 8

The Precision Scientific Instrument Company manufactures thermometers that are supposed to give readings of at the freezing poin
tatyana61 [14]

Answer:

The 96^{th} percentile is 1.751                                    

Step-by-step explanation:

The following information is missing in the question:

Mean,

\mu = 0^\circ C

Standard Deviation,

\sigma = 1^\circ C

We are given that the distribution of distribution of errors is a bell shaped distribution that is a normal distribution.

Formula:

z_{score} = \displaystyle\frac{x-\mu}{\sigma}

We have to find the value of x such that the probability is 0.96

P( X < x) = P( z < \displaystyle\frac{x - 0}{1})=0.96  

Calculation the value from standard normal z table, we have,  

\displaystyle\frac{x}{1} = 1.751\\\\x = 1.751

P_{96} = 1.751

1.751 degree Celsius is the thermometer reading corresponding to 96^{th} percentile.
